Weinwandertag Obertürkheim — edition 2026
Ascension Day 2026 in the Stuttgart Vineyards
On Thursday, May 14, 2026 (Ascension Day), the Stuttgarter Weinmanufaktur Untertürkheim eG invites you again to the traditional wine hike through the Obertürkheim vineyards. The start is at 11:00 a.m. at Obertürkheim station — from there, the hiking route leads through the steep slopes around Ailenberg.
Four tasting stations punctuate the route. At each station, Obertürkheim vintners and families serve their Württemberg wines directly in the vineyards — Trollinger, Lemberger, Riesling, Müller-Thurgau. The Trautwein family from the "Zur Linde" restaurant provides the culinary catering with Swabian Vesper.

Ascension Day through the Stuttgart Vineyards
The Weinwandertag Obertürkheim is a fixed date in Stuttgart's spring calendar: On Ascension Day — in 2026, that's Thursday, May 14 — a hike starts through the vineyards of eastern Stuttgart. Starting from Obertürkheim station, the route goes uphill to Ailenberg and through the vineyards of the Trautwein family and their neighbors. Four tasting stations punctuate the path — a mix of a sporting hike and a wine tasting.
Four Tasting Stations Along the Way
The four tasting stations are set up by vintners and families from Obertürkheim. They serve their Trollinger, Lemberger, Riesling, Müller-Thurgau, and other Württemberg classics directly in the vineyards. Between stations, the walk continues on foot — the route leads through the typical steep slopes of the Stuttgart wine-growing region with its characteristic stone walls.
The Trautwein Family and the Restaurant Zur Linde
The Trautwein family from the traditional restaurant "Zur Linde" in Obertürkheim is responsible for the culinary catering at the start, stations, and finish. Sausage salad, Maultaschen, Swabian Vesper classics, plus sweets from the cake buffet — a Swabian midday meal in the vineyards without the stress of a restaurant visit.
Destination: The Historic Obertürkheim Kelter
The hiking route ends at the historic Obertürkheim Kelter — one of the most important wine-growing buildings in the Stuttgart wine region. Here, the day concludes with further tastings, live music (typically Swabian folk music or accordion), and a relaxed Hocketse atmosphere. Thousands of Stuttgart residents and guests from the greater metropolitan area use the public holiday for the tour.
Obertürkheim and Stuttgart's Winegrowing
Obertürkheim is a district in eastern Stuttgart on the Neckar River, traditionally a wine village. Here — as in Untertürkheim, Uhlbach, Mühlhausen, and Hedelfingen — the Stuttgart vineyards are located on steep slopes that shape the cityscape. With the Stuttgarter Weinmanufaktur Untertürkheim eG, one of Stuttgart's best-known wineries is behind the Weinwandertag — also an important anchor of identity for Obertürkheim and the entire quartet of wine villages.
Sport, Wine, Tradition
The Weinwandertag is a Swabian specialty: it's not primarily about sport (the route is manageable, about 5–7 km with moderate inclines), not primarily about wine (the quantities per station are small), but about the combination of moderate exercise in the vineyards, social gatherings with friends and family, Swabian Vesper, and wine tasting — and it is precisely this mix that creates its charm.
